FAQs for countertops installation projects in Lafayette, CO

Porcelain countertops provide an affordable alternative to granite countertops. Granite installations cost $50 to $200 per square foot, while porcelain costs $50 to $70 per square foot. High-end porcelain prices surpass those of lower-grade granite installations, yet standard off-the-shelf porcelain remains less expensive than most granite options. The material is non-porous, UV-proof, maintenance-free, and exhibits superior damage resistance.

Porcelain countertops offer an improved value when compared with quartz countertops. Quartz installations cost $50 to $200 per square foot, while porcelain costs $50 to $70 per square foot. Lower-quality builder’s grade quartz incorporates additional resin and fillers that diminish its vibrancy and performance. Porcelain resists heat and staining and minimizes surface damage, making it a superior and resilient choice for discerning homeowners.

Porcelain countertops are exceptionally durable and rarely chip during everyday use. They are stronger and more resistant to damage than many natural stone options. However, if a heavy object causes a chip, it can be challenging to repair. Replacing the affected section may be the best solution to maintain the countertop's appearance.

Installing a porcelain countertop takes between one and three days, depending on the size and complexity of your project. The installation process includes removing the old countertop, taking precise measurements, making necessary cutouts, and installing the new countertop properly. Porcelain slabs are engineered with a defined thickness that balances aesthetics and functionality. They measure either 1/4-inch or 1/2-inch to accommodate diverse applications such as wall cladding, shower surrounds, and cabinet facades. The slim profile demands expert handling during fabrication and installation to preserve structural integrity and visual appeal.
